Challenges in Architectural Thesis Projects

Common Student Difficulties

Completing an architectural thesis is fraught with challenges. Students often face difficulties such as narrowing down their research focus, managing time effectively, and maintaining motivation throughout the project. Additionally, balancing creativity with academic rigor can be daunting.

Time Management Strategies

To overcome these challenges, students should employ strategic time management techniques. Setting clear, attainable goals and establishing a realistic timeline are crucial. Prioritizing tasks and seeking feedback from peers and mentors can also enhance productivity and ensure steady progress.

Structuring Your Architectural Thesis

Thesis Proposal

The first step in structuring an architectural thesis is developing a solid proposal. This document should outline the research question, objectives, and proposed methodology. A well-crafted proposal serves as a roadmap for the entire project.

Research Methodology

Choosing an appropriate research methodology is vital. Students should consider qualitative, quantitative, or mixed-method approaches based on their research questions. Methodological rigor ensures the validity and reliability of research findings.

Design and Analysis

Design and analysis are core components of the thesis. Students must demonstrate their ability to synthesize research insights into innovative architectural designs. This involves iterative design processes, critical evaluation, and refinement of ideas.
